Muslin Magic: Mottled Backdrops for Unique Appearances
Unleash the beauty of muslin fabrics ! Their naturally mottled surface provides a wonderful canvas for generating truly innovative photographic images . This simple material provides a soft light and a rustic feel, perfect for portraits and commercial work. Rather than stark, flat backgrounds, muslin brings a dimension and organic aesthetic that can enhance any shot. Its adaptability also permits for easy coloring and manipulation , opening up limitless avenues for personalized designs.

Photography Backdrops vs. Theatre Event Displays: Significant Differences
While both picture backdrops and stage event backdrops serve as visual scenes, their intended use and building differ greatly. Photo backdrops are typically created to be clean, often showing a consistent image or texture that complements the subject. They are commonly constructed from cloth, material, or plastic, and focus portability and convenience of placement. In contrast, performance event backdrops are intricate scenery that illustrate entire locations to engage the spectators in the story. These are usually built from various pieces of structures, fabric, and paint, and may include lighting and unique elements.
Here’s a short summary:
- Photo Backdrops: Easy and centered on person presentation.
- Theatre Event Backdrops: Imposing and designed for immersive storytelling.
Transcending the Essentials: Novel Backdrop Techniques
Stepping beyond the standard white sheet or simple fabric drape, current photographers are experimenting with truly original backdrop answers . Consider utilizing projection mapping to build dynamic, ever-changing scenes, or building multi-layered installations with recycled materials for a textured feel. Different approaches involve using natural elements like logs and foliage, or designing elaborate paper sculptures to become integral parts of the picture . The key is on visual communication and adding layers to the final aesthetic.
